Balmain Tigers Ambassadors Keith Barnes, Larry Corowa, Benny Elias, Mark O’Neill, Sid Ryan, Darren Senter, Paul Sironen and Wayne Pearce will also be at Birchgrove along with Wests legends Keith Holman, Arthur Summons, Noel Kelly, Harry Wells, John Hayes, Bill Owens, Jack Thompson, Carl Ross, Tim Murphy and Barry Glasgow. http://www.weeklytimes.com.au/ |
